Wilfrid Laurier University’s Seagram Drive Athletics & Recreation facility (University Stadium) holds a special place in the heart of Waterloo. It’s a space where Laurier students, alumni and community come together to demonstrate athletic excellence, to foster wellness and to build community vibrance.
Built in 1957, University Stadium has been home to many historic moments over its 66+ years.
However, the facility is now in need of serious repair. Age and significant use have taken its toll on the complex’s seating area, field and structure. Currently, due to the critical repairs needed, the stadium’s usage is dramatically impeded.
Subject to further Board of Governors approval and donor support, Laurier is planning for a phased redevelopment of University Stadium and enhancements to provide top-level recreational and wellness facilities.
